Effective Ways to Control Invasive Non-Native Plant Species and Promote Indigenous Plants

Invasive non-native plant species can have detrimental effects on ecosystems, biodiversity, and the growth of indigenous plants. To counteract these negative impacts, it is essential to employ effective strategies to control invasive plants while simultaneously promoting the growth of indigenous species. This article will explore several methods that can be utilized to achieve this objective.

1. Manual Removal

Manual removal involves physically uprooting or cutting down invasive plants. This method is most effective for small-scale infestations or areas where machinery is challenging to access. It is crucial to ensure proper disposal of the removed plants to prevent regrowth.

2. Chemical Control

Chemical control involves using herbicides or systemic chemicals to target and eliminate invasive plants. It is essential to choose herbicides specifically formulated for the target species to avoid harming indigenous plants. Careful application following safety guidelines is necessary to minimize environmental impact.

3. Biological Control

Biological control involves using natural enemies, such as insects or pathogens, to suppress invasive plant populations. Extensive research and consideration must be given to ensure the biological control agent poses no threat to indigenous plants or other native organisms.

4. Mulching

Mulching is an effective method that involves covering the soil around indigenous plants with organic materials like wood chips or straw. This helps suppress the growth of invasive plants by blocking sunlight, smothering weeds, and conserving soil moisture for indigenous plants.

5. Controlled Burns

Controlled burns are a technique used to manage invasive plants and promote the growth of indigenous species. This method involves carefully setting controlled fires to eliminate invasive plants while allowing indigenous plants adapted to fire to regenerate.

6. Plant Competition

Plant competition can be utilized as a natural method to control invasive non-native plants. By introducing competitive indigenous plants that are resilient and adapted to the ecosystem, they can outcompete invasive species for resources like sunlight, nutrients, and water.

7. Education and Awareness

Education and awareness play a vital role in controlling invasive plants and promoting indigenous species. By educating the public about the negative impacts of invasive plants, individuals can take action to prevent their spread and promote the growth of indigenous plants in their surroundings.

Plant Identification and Indigenous Plants

Accurate plant identification is crucial for effective control of invasive non-native plants while preserving and promoting indigenous species. It allows for proper identification of invasive plants, distinguishing them from indigenous plants that need protection. Plant identification techniques include recognizing distinctive leaf shapes, flower structures, stem characteristics, and growth habits.

Promoting indigenous plants is essential for maintaining biodiversity and preserving native ecosystems. Indigenous plants have adapted to local environmental conditions and provide habitat and food for native wildlife. By planting indigenous species, we can create sustainable and resilient ecosystems that are less susceptible to invasions by non-native plants.
